Garza County Texas Sheriff Overview

Garza County can be found in the western area of Texas. Post – is the county seat. Garza County has a total population of 6528 and was formed in 1876.

Garza County has a total area of 893 square miles. The zip codes in Garza County are 79330, 79356.

Commissary Accounts in Garza County Regional Juvenile Center

Commissary accounts are the resources that an inmate in Garza County Regional Juvenile Center, TX can use to access funds while in custody. These financial accounts are accessible based on the Garza County prison’s various limitations for all inmates.

The funds are also only available for purchases the Garza County Regional Juvenile Center approves. Usually, these accounts include phones or commissary orders for accessing the funds. The deposit process can occur through the following avenues:

  • Through online-based platforms such as Access Corrections. It’s the main financial service for the Garza County Regional Juvenile Center and provides a convenient approach for adding funds to an inmate’s account. 
  • Through phone calls, you can make deposits through the Access Correction platforms. You can contact the Garza County Regional Juvenile Center through phone calls on 806-495-0266.
  • The Lobby Kiosk is an ATM-style Kiosk that accepts inmates’ cash deposits.
  • Mail platforms that involve the user of Money Orders and Cashier’s Checks. Once the individual receives the checks, the cashier processes the data and stores it in a database.
  • The use of friends and family can help with ordering items such as food through the Garza County Regional Juvenile Center’s online canteen.
